CURRENT MARKET CONDITIONS

As of April 2026, the Ridley School District is a seller’s market. With 1.52 months of inventory, a median list price of $335,000, and homes spending just 12 days on market, demand significantly outpaces available supply across Folsom, Ridley Park, and Morton. These conditions reflect a competitive environment where limited inventory and rapid absorption rates continue to favor sellers.

Ridley Communities & Neighborhoods

Ridley School District includes Ridley Township, Eddystone Borough, and Ridley Park Borough in southeastern Delaware County, with compact borough centers and established neighborhoods along the I-95 and Chester Pike corridors.

Ridley Township

Ridley Township — Southeastern Delaware County township that includes communities like Folsom, Woodlyn, Crum Lynne, and Holmes, with established neighborhoods and convenient access to I-95, I-476, and Chester Pike.

Ridley Park Borough

Ridley Park Borough — Compact suburban borough founded as a railroad-era community, known for its Victorian homes, town center, and proximity to I-95 and regional rail service into Philadelphia.

Eddystone Borough

Eddystone Borough — Small Delaware River borough with residential blocks, local parks, and quick access to nearby industrial employment centers and regional transportation routes.

Folsom & Woodlyn

Folsom & Woodlyn — Ridley Township census-designated places (CDPs) with tree-lined residential streets, neighborhood shopping along MacDade Boulevard, and close ties to township schools and facilities.

Chester Pike Corridor

Chester Pike Corridor — U.S. Route 13 corridor that links Ridley Township, Ridley Park, and Eddystone with a mix of commercial uses, local services, and adjoining residential neighborhoods.

Ridley Park Lake & Municipal Parks

Ridley Park Lake & Municipal Parks — A network of township and borough parks, highlighted by Ridley Park Lake and Ridley Municipal Park, offering green space, walking areas, and athletic fields near surrounding homes.

Why People Choose Ridley

Ridley School District brings together Ridley Township, Eddystone Borough, and Ridley Park Borough in southeastern Delaware County, with neighborhoods running from the Delaware River and I-95 corridor up toward the Chester Pike and MacDade Boulevard commercial corridors.

✓ Three-Community District Footprint
Ridley School District serves Ridley Township, Eddystone Borough, and Ridley Park Borough under one K–12 system, with compact borough centers and multiple Ridley Township neighborhoods sharing the same schools and core local services.

✓ Connectivity & Commuting Options
Major routes such as I-95, I-476, U.S. Route 13 (Chester Pike), and Pennsylvania Route 291, along with nearby SEPTA bus and regional rail connections, give Ridley-area commuters direct access to Philadelphia, the airport, and employment hubs across Delaware County.

✓ Parks, Waterfront & Community Spaces
Ridley Municipal Park, neighborhood playing fields, and destinations like Ridley Park Lake provide everyday outdoor space, walking routes, and community gathering spots woven into established residential streets.

✓ Variety of Suburban Housing Choices
